What the data says
Global Payments's capital returned to shareholders of $1.4B is higher than 85% of companies in the Financials sector (FY2025). Capital Returned to Shareholders has fluctuated over the past 10 years, ranging from $3M in FY2016 to $3.2B in FY2022.
Based on SEC 10-K filings.
$1.4B in FY2025 with a 5-year CAGR of +46.1%. Top quartile in the Financials sector.
Improved from $679M to $1.4B over the past 2 years.

Annual data
| Year | Capital Returned to ShareholdersValue | YoY GrowthYoY |
|---|---|---|
| FY2025 | $1.4B | -20.8% |
| FY2024 | $1.8B | +165.9% |
| FY2023 | $678.7M | -78.8% |
| FY2022 | $3.2B | +14.4% |
| FY2021 | $2.8B | +1202.1% |
| FY2020 | $214.5M | +516.3% |
| FY2019 | $34.8M | +540.0% |
| FY2018 | $5.4M | -84.4% |
| FY2017 | $34.8M | +1034.3% |
| FY2016 | $3.1M | -43.6% |
